区块链如何保证数据同步(区块链如何保证数据同步)

2024-12-19 可靠的加密货币交易所 阅读 2156
区块链技术通过分布式账本的方式存储和传递信息,确保了数据的安全性和完整性。在实现这一目标时,需要解决以下几个关键问题:,,1. **共识机制**:块链依赖于一个共识机制来决定哪些节点同意某个交易或状态变更。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。,,2. **链上验证**:每个区块都包含前一个区块的哈希值,从而形成一个不可篡改的链条。这有助于防止重复交易和伪造。,,3. **分片与去中心化**:将区块链分成多个小块(分片),每个分片可以独立运行,减少单点故障的风险。去中心化的设计使得网络更加分散,降低了集中性风险。,,4. **智能合约**:智能合约是自动执行的代码,可以用于自动化执行复杂的业务逻辑,如资产交换、贷款审批等。它们可以在不信任第三方的情况下进行安全交易。,,5. **数据同步**:为了保证不同节点之间的数据一致性,需要定期进行数据同步。这可以通过多种方式实现,如使用异步编程、增量同步或全量同步。,,6. **安全性**:区块链的数据是加密的,因此即使节点被攻击,也无法读取其他节点的未加密数据。,,7. **性能优化**:区块链的高可扩展性和低延迟特性使其成为处理大量交易的理想选择。同步和更新操作可能会对系统性能产生一定影响。,,区块链通过精心设计的共识机制、高效的分片和去中心化架构以及智能合约等技术手段,实现了数据的安全同步和高效传输。
区块链如何保证数据同步

在当今数字时代,数据的处理和传输变得越来越复杂,传统的集中式系统虽然能够高效地存储和管理大量数据,但同时也面临着数据安全、隐私保护和分布式信任等问题,而区块链作为一种去中心化的技术,以其独特的特性为解决这些问题提供了新的思路。

区块链如何保证数据同步(区块链如何保证数据同步)

基本概念

区块链是一种基于密码学算法的数据结构,它将数据分成一个个区块,并通过网络中的节点进行验证和传播,每个区块包含一组交易记录以及一个哈希值,这些哈希值可以用来验证区块的内容是否完整,以及之前的区块是否正确链接。

数据同步机制

在区块链中,数据同步是一个关键问题,为了确保所有节点上的数据一致,区块链采用了多种同步机制:

1、全量同步:每个节点都下载并存储整个区块链的历史数据。

2、增量同步:只下载和应用新添加的区块,而不是整个历史数据。

3、状态同步:同步节点的状态信息,包括未确认的交易和已确认的交易。

数据一致性

为了保持数据的一致性,区块链使用了共识算法来决定哪些节点应该成为新的区块创建者,常见的共识算法包括PoW(工作量证明)、PoS(权益证明)和DPOS(Delegated Proof of Stake)等。

高效性与性能

由于区块链的去中心化特性,数据同步过程通常比传统系统更快,这是因为没有中间服务器,减少了延迟和开销,区块链的设计也使得数据的访问和修改更加便捷,因为所有的更改都是公开透明的。

安全性

尽管区块链具有去中心化的特点,但它并不完全免疫于各种攻击,现代区块链技术已经采取了许多措施来提高安全性,如加密算法、防篡改机制和权限控制等。

区块链作为一种强大的工具,其数据同步机制为解决数据安全、隐私保护和分布式信任等问题提供了有效的解决方案,随着技术的进步,我们可以期待区块链在未来继续发挥更大的作用,为我们的生活带来更多的便利和安全。

区块链如何保证数据同步(区块链如何保证数据同步)区块链如何保证数据同步

文章评论

相关推荐

  • 区块链如何保证数据同步(区块链如何保证数据同步) 币安app官方下载

    比特币关停了怎么办

    比特币(BTC)作为加密货币,由于其去中心化和匿名性等特点,在全球范围内受到广泛关注。随着技术的发展和社会对金融稳定性的需求增加,许多国家和地区开始对比特币进行监管。当比特币被关闭时,需要考虑以下几个方面:,,1. **法律后果**:在一些地方,比特...

    2024年12月17日 4682
  • 区块链如何保证数据同步(区块链如何保证数据同步) 欧易网页版

    欧意交易所论坛官网入口(探索欧意交易所论坛,连接全球金融的桥梁)

    欧意交易所论坛是一个由欧意证券集团提供的在线交流平台,旨在为全球投资者和企业人士提供一个了解市场动态、获取行业信息和参与讨论的场所。欧意交易所论坛官网入口欧意交易所论坛(European Interbank Exchange Forum)作为欧洲最大...

    2024年12月17日 4995
  • 区块链如何保证数据同步(区块链如何保证数据同步) 币安app官方下载

    比特币有多少域名(一个数字世界中的神秘存在)

    比特币是一个由中本聪创造的一种数字货币,最初用于支付交易费用。它没有官方的域名或标识符,因为其身份和性质不同于传统的互联网资源。在某些加密货币社区中,人们尝试为比特币创建独特的标识符,BTC”或“Bitcoins”,但这并不意味着比特币本身拥有这些标...

    2024年12月17日 4399
  • 区块链如何保证数据同步(区块链如何保证数据同步) 币安app官方下载

    哪里买到比特币(全球各地的比特币市场现状及购买建议)

    比特币作为一种去中心化的数字货币,其价格波动较大。在不同地区,比特币的价格和交易方式可能会有所不同。以下是一些常见地区的比特币市场状况:,,1. **美国**:美国是比特币的主要消费国之一,许多金融和科技公司都在探索将比特币作为支付工具。,,2. *...

    2024年12月17日 3662
  • 区块链如何保证数据同步(区块链如何保证数据同步) 可靠的加密货币交易所

    区块链为什么要涌入中国(区块链为何要涌入中国?)

    近年来,随着技术的发展和政策的支持,区块链在多个领域得到广泛应用。区块链的应用也日益广泛,包括金融服务、供应链管理、版权保护等。中国的区块链发展还面临着一些挑战,如监管环境不完善、人才短缺、技术和市场认知度低等问题。为了解决这些问题,中国政府正在加大...

    2024年12月17日 3712
  • 区块链如何保证数据同步(区块链如何保证数据同步) 正规数字货币交易平台

    什么是虚拟货币钱包(理解虚拟货币钱包,数字货币的存储与管理工具)

    虚拟货币钱包是一种专门用于存储和管理加密货币(如比特币、以太坊等)的软件应用程序。它允许用户创建账户并安全地保存他们的私钥,从而控制他们的数字货币。钱包通常包含多个功能模块,包括地址管理、交易记录、资金转移等功能。使用虚拟货币钱包可以帮助用户更好地管...

    2024年12月17日 4265
  • 区块链如何保证数据同步(区块链如何保证数据同步) 币安app官方下载

    比特时代是什么币(数字货币的革命性崛起)

    比特时代是比特币(BTC)作为数字货币的革命性崛起。比特币是一种基于区块链技术的去中心化、点对点的数字货币,拥有高度的匿名性和安全性。比特币的出现标志着数字经济的发展进入了一个全新的阶段,改变了金融体系和支付方式。与其他数字货币相比,比特币以其独特的...

    2024年12月17日 4427
  • 区块链如何保证数据同步(区块链如何保证数据同步) 可靠的加密货币交易所

    区块链星球怎么样(开启数字世界的革命力量)

    区块链星球正引领一场前所未有的技术变革,它通过分布式账本技术打破数据孤岛,实现信息的透明、安全和可追溯。从金融交易到供应链管理,再到医疗健康等各行各业,区块链的应用正在不断扩展,为人们的生活带来更加便捷、高效和安全的体验。作为全球领先的区块链企业之一...

    2024年12月17日 2813
  • 区块链如何保证数据同步(区块链如何保证数据同步) 币安最新官网

    币安秘钥在哪里(揭秘币安密钥的隐藏秘密)

    要查询币安的API密钥,请访问以下网址:https://coinbase.com/api/v3/account/keys。这将要求您使用 Coinbase账户进行身份验证,并且可能会受到限制。不要在公共平台上分享您的API密钥,以防止未经授权的访问。...

    2024年12月17日 1745
  • 区块链如何保证数据同步(区块链如何保证数据同步) 正规数字货币交易平台

    为什么要出现虚拟货币(虚拟货币,未来经济的催化剂?)

    虚拟货币作为一种新兴的数字资产,近年来在市场中引起了广泛关注。它们代表了一种新的经济形式,具有独特的价值和潜力。随着技术的发展和监管政策的制定,虚拟货币在未来可能成为推动全球经济的重要力量之一。虚拟货币也可能引发一些伦理和社会问题,因此需要谨慎对待和...

    2024年12月17日 2550